Theatre of Lights
2nd St and K St, Sacramento, CA 95812
Monday, Dec 31 7:00 pm & 8:30 pm
The fourth annual Raley’s Theatre of Lights is a free holiday program of the Old Sacramento Business Association. Narrated by American literary icon Mark Twain, the live-action retelling of Moore’s 1823 poem — “A Visit from St. Nicholas,” more popularly known as “‘Twas the Night Before Christmas” — promises to be bigger and better than ever. New year’s Eve will feature the fireworks spectacular with shows at 7 pm and 8:30 pm. CLICK HERE for more information.
